Old Christmas Day



January 6th is Old Christmas Day here in Newfoundland. At our house we like to keep the season going so we honor Old Christmas Day. Today we had a gathering of close friends and family. There was food, laughter, and fun for all. Having Charis Maloy with us brought another dimension to the festivities.
